Changeset 22535


Ignore:
Timestamp:
2010-08-08T21:13:52+02:00 (6 years ago)
Author:
mb
Message:

mac80211: Add p54spi driver

File:
1 edited

Legend:

Unmodified
Added
Removed
  • trunk/package/mac80211/Makefile

    r22419 r22535  
    9393P54PCIFW:=2.13.12.0.arm 
    9494P54USBFW:=2.13.24.0.lm87.arm 
     95P54SPIFW:=2.13.0.0.a.13.14.arm 
    9596 
    9697define Download/p54usb 
     
    108109$(eval $(call Download,p54pci)) 
    109110 
     111define Download/p54spi 
     112  FILE:=$(P54SPIFW) 
     113  URL:=http://daemonizer.de/prism54/prism54-fw/stlc4560 
     114  MD5SUM:=42661f8ecbadd88012807493f596081d 
     115endef 
     116$(eval $(call Download,p54spi)) 
     117 
    110118define KernelPackage/p54/Default 
    111119  $(call KernelPackage/mac80211/Default) 
     
    119127define KernelPackage/p54-common 
    120128  $(call KernelPackage/p54/Default) 
    121   DEPENDS+= @PCI_SUPPORT||@USB_SUPPORT +kmod-mac80211 
     129  DEPENDS+= @PCI_SUPPORT||@USB_SUPPORT||@TARGET_omap24xx +kmod-mac80211 
    122130  TITLE+= (COMMON) 
    123131  FILES:=$(PKG_BUILD_DIR)/drivers/net/wireless/p54/p54common.ko 
     
    139147  FILES:=$(PKG_BUILD_DIR)/drivers/net/wireless/p54/p54usb.ko 
    140148  AUTOLOAD:=$(call AutoLoad,31,p54usb) 
     149endef 
     150 
     151define KernelPackage/p54-spi 
     152  $(call KernelPackage/p54/Default) 
     153  TITLE+= (SPI) 
     154  DEPENDS+= @TARGET_omap24xx +kmod-p54-common 
     155  FILES:=$(PKG_BUILD_DIR)/drivers/net/wireless/p54/p54spi.ko 
     156  AUTOLOAD:=$(call AutoLoad,31,p54spi) 
    141157endef 
    142158 
     
    851867        CONFIG_P54_PCI=$(if $(CONFIG_PACKAGE_kmod-p54-pci),m) \ 
    852868        CONFIG_P54_USB=$(if $(CONFIG_PACKAGE_kmod-p54-usb),m) \ 
    853         CONFIG_P54_SPI= \ 
     869        CONFIG_P54_SPI=$(if $(CONFIG_PACKAGE_kmod-p54-spi),m) \ 
    854870        CONFIG_RT2X00=$(if $(CONFIG_PACKAGE_kmod-rt2x00-lib),m) \ 
    855871        CONFIG_RT2X00_LIB=$(if $(CONFIG_PACKAGE_kmod-rt2x00-lib),m) \ 
     
    981997endef 
    982998 
     999define KernelPackage/p54-spi/install 
     1000        $(INSTALL_DIR) $(1)/lib/firmware 
     1001        $(INSTALL_DATA) $(DL_DIR)/$(P54SPIFW) $(1)/lib/firmware/3826.arm 
     1002endef 
     1003 
    9831004define KernelPackage/rt61-pci/install 
    9841005        $(INSTALL_DIR) $(1)/lib/firmware 
     
    10771098$(eval $(call KernelPackage,p54-pci)) 
    10781099$(eval $(call KernelPackage,p54-usb)) 
     1100$(eval $(call KernelPackage,p54-spi)) 
    10791101$(eval $(call KernelPackage,rt2x00-lib)) 
    10801102$(eval $(call KernelPackage,rt2x00-pci)) 
Note: See TracChangeset for help on using the changeset viewer.